Post-Conflict Peacebuilding Course concludes at RPA
Musanze, 7 May 2021
The Senior Leadership for Post-Conflict Peacebuilding and Reconstruction Course concluded today at the Rwanda Peace Academy (RPA) in Musanze District. The course attended by Twenty-five senior military and police officers from South Sudan (Maj Gen – Lt Gen), started on 3 May 2021, and was organized by RPA in partnership with the United Nations Institute for Training and Research (UNITAR) and the Reconstituted Joint Monitoring and Evaluation Commission (RJMEC).
On behalf of the South Sudanese Generals that attended the course, Maj Gen Peter Mabior Riiny Lual said that unity, accountability and thinking big sum up what they have learnt in five days in Rwanda. “We have seen with our eyes the miracle of thinking big. What it can do to a country that was devastated by war to a flame of hope. We ensure that we are ready to put South Sudan interests above anything. We have learnt how the Rwanda Defence Force contributes to the socio-economic development of Rwanda and work for the people, and we take home the slogan of “one people, one nation’,” said Maj Gen Lual.
The South Sudanese Minister of Defence and Veterans Affairs, Hon. Angelina Jany Teny noted that this was a very useful encounter for her delegation, emphasizing that the generals have learnt their role in building peace and creating stability. “Personally, while being here in Rwanda, I have had discussion with the Minister of Defence on possibilities of continuing these kinds of training and support to the implementation of our peace agreement and helping in the transformation of our organized forces because we have seen how the army here and other forces have become self-sufficient ” said Hon. Jany Teny.
